Structured data allows search engines to not only crawl your site, but to truly understand it. Structured data is the “extra” information that you see next to a website and meta description. For example, if you are searching for a restaurant, you will see not only the restaurant’s name, but also additional information such as hours, pricing and stars to indicate positive reviews.

Structured data is a system of pairing a name with a value that helps search engines categorize and index your content. Microdata is one form of structured data that works with HTML5. Schema.org is a project that provides a particular set of agreed-upon definitions for microdata tags.

Structured data is a piece of code that you can put on your website. It’s code in a specific format, written in such a way that search engines understand it. Search engines read the code and use it to display search results in a specific way.
